HATs (Hardware Attached on Top) extend a Raspberry Pi’s capability well beyond its base GPIO pins — these are the ones that solve genuinely common project needs rather than being novelty add-ons.
A PoE HAT for power-and-data-in-one installs
A Power over Ethernet HAT eliminates the need for a separate power cable entirely, a real convenience for a Pi mounted somewhere a power outlet is inconvenient to reach.

An RTC HAT for accurate offline timekeeping
A real-time clock HAT keeps accurate time even without internet access to sync from, important for any offline or air-gapped project that logs timestamped data.

A relay HAT for controlling real-world hardware
A relay HAT lets a Pi safely switch higher-voltage devices — sprinklers, lights, small appliances — directly from GPIO commands, a common building block for home automation projects.

- 4 Independent Channels: Control multiple devices separately with 4 onboard relays (250V/5A per channel)
- High-Current Design: Supports motors, lights, and appliances up to 250V/5A per relay
- Dual Protection: Optocoupler isolation combined with jumper-selectable pins for anti-interference and flexibility
Confirm HAT compatibility with your specific Pi model before buying — the 40-pin header has stayed consistent, but some HATs have physical clearance issues with certain case designs.
